About Rasit Onur Topaloglu

Rasit Onur Topaloglu is a scholar working on Hardware and Architecture, Electrical and Electronic Engineering and Industrial and Manufacturing Engineering, having authored 70 papers that have together received 696 indexed citations. Recurring topics across this work include Advancements in Photolithography Techniques (20 papers), VLSI and Analog Circuit Testing (15 papers), Integrated Circuits and Semiconductor Failure Analysis (14 papers), VLSI and FPGA Design Techniques (11 papers), Quantum Computing Algorithms and Architecture (11 papers), Advancements in Semiconductor Devices and Circuit Design (11 papers), Low-power high-performance VLSI design (8 papers) and 3D IC and TSV technologies (8 papers). The work is most often cited by research in Hardware and Architecture (159 citations), Electrical and Electronic Engineering (509 citations) and Industrial and Manufacturing Engineering (47 citations). Rasit Onur Topaloglu has collaborated with scholars based in United States, Canada and Türkiye. Frequent co-authors include Andrew B. Kahng, Swaroop Ghosh, Puneet Sharma, Martin D. F. Wong, Yuelin Du, Hongbo Zhang, Abdullah Ash Saki, Sung Kyu Lim, Dae Hyun Kim and Kwangok Jeong.
